PER CURIAM.
The plaintiff, Edward Jaksha, a Nebraska resident and owner of taxable personal and real property in the state, seeks a declaratory judgment as to the constitutionality of 1991 Neb.Laws, L.B. 829, which the Legislature passed with an emergency clause, and the Governor signed into law on June 10, 1991.
